Why governance is the real adoption challenge in healthcare ERP
Healthcare ERP programs rarely fail because finance or supply chain teams lack functional expertise. They struggle because governance does not resolve competing priorities across patient access, billing, procurement, inventory, accounts payable, contracting, and compliance. Revenue cycle leaders may prioritize charge capture, denial prevention, and cash acceleration. Supply chain leaders may prioritize item availability, contract compliance, and spend visibility. Both are valid, but without a shared governance structure, the ERP program becomes a collection of local optimizations.
A business-first governance model should define who owns enterprise process standards, who approves exceptions, how data quality is measured, and how trade-offs are escalated. In healthcare, this is especially important because operational disruption can affect patient services, clinician productivity, and financial resilience at the same time. Governance therefore must extend beyond steering committees. It should include decision forums for master data, integration dependencies, security and identity and access management, compliance review, release management, and operational readiness.
What business outcomes should guide revenue cycle and supply chain alignment
The strongest healthcare ERP programs begin by defining a small set of enterprise outcomes that both functions can support. Typical examples include cleaner financial close, more reliable cost-to-serve visibility, fewer manual reconciliations, stronger purchasing discipline, improved chargeable supply traceability, and better working capital control. These outcomes create a common language between finance, operations, and technology teams.
| Business objective | Revenue cycle implication | Supply chain implication | Governance requirement |
|---|---|---|---|
| Improve margin visibility | More accurate charge and reimbursement mapping | Better item cost attribution and contract pricing control | Shared data definitions and finance-approved reporting logic |
| Reduce avoidable leakage | Fewer billing exceptions and manual write-offs | Lower maverick spend and inventory variance | Cross-functional exception management and root-cause review |
| Increase operational resilience | Fewer claim delays caused by missing or inconsistent data | More reliable replenishment and vendor performance oversight | Integrated process ownership and continuity planning |
| Accelerate decision-making | Faster insight into collections and denials trends | Faster insight into spend, stock, and supplier risk | Executive dashboards with common KPIs and escalation thresholds |
This alignment matters because many healthcare organizations still manage revenue and supply chain data in separate systems, with inconsistent item masters, chart of accounts mappings, and approval workflows. ERP adoption governance should therefore be designed to reduce friction at these intersections. The program should not ask whether finance or supply chain wins. It should ask which process design best supports enterprise performance, compliance, and service continuity.
A decision framework for selecting the right governance model
Not every healthcare organization needs the same governance structure. A regional provider network with decentralized purchasing and mixed legacy systems will require a different model than a single integrated delivery network standardizing on a cloud-native architecture. The right approach depends on operating complexity, regulatory exposure, data maturity, and implementation capacity.
- Centralized governance is best when the organization needs strong standardization, common controls, and enterprise-wide process harmonization across finance, procurement, inventory, and reporting.
- Federated governance is better when local entities require controlled flexibility, but enterprise standards still govern master data, security, compliance, and KPI definitions.
- Hybrid governance works when the organization wants centralized policy and architecture decisions while allowing phased local adoption based on readiness, acquisition history, or service line complexity.
Executives should evaluate governance options against five criteria: speed of decision-making, ability to enforce process standards, impact on local operations, data stewardship maturity, and post-go-live support capacity. How discovery and assessment should be structured before design begins
Discovery and assessment should establish the factual baseline for governance decisions. In healthcare ERP programs, this means more than documenting current-state workflows. The assessment should identify where revenue cycle and supply chain processes intersect, where data ownership is unclear, and where manual workarounds create financial or operational risk. Business process analysis should cover patient billing dependencies, item and vendor master governance, purchasing approvals, inventory valuation, contract pricing, chargeable supplies, accounts payable controls, and reporting logic used by finance and operations.
A strong assessment also reviews the application landscape, integration strategy, cloud migration constraints, security model, and operational support model. If the target environment includes multi-tenant SaaS or dedicated cloud deployment, governance must address release cadence, configuration ownership, environment management, and business continuity expectations. If the architecture includes Kubernetes, Docker, PostgreSQL, Redis, or cloud-native integration services, those components should only be introduced where they directly support resilience, scalability, or managed cloud services requirements. Technology choices should follow operating model decisions, not lead them.
What solution design must include to support adoption rather than just configuration
Solution design should translate business priorities into a governed target operating model. That includes process design, role design, approval structures, exception handling, reporting ownership, and integration boundaries. In healthcare, design quality is often determined by how well the ERP supports the handoff points: requisition to purchase order, receipt to invoice, item usage to charge capture, denial analysis to root-cause correction, and close-to-reporting workflows across finance and operations.
Adoption-focused design also requires explicit decisions on workflow automation, user experience, and training burden. Over-automation can create brittle processes if exception handling is weak. Under-automation preserves manual effort and slows ROI. The right balance depends on process stability, policy maturity, and the organization's ability to monitor outcomes. AI-assisted implementation can help accelerate documentation, test preparation, and issue triage, but governance should define where human review remains mandatory, especially for financial controls, compliance-sensitive workflows, and master data changes.
An implementation roadmap that reduces disruption and improves accountability
| Phase | Primary objective | Key governance actions | Executive checkpoint |
|---|---|---|---|
| Mobilize | Confirm scope, outcomes, and sponsorship | Establish steering structure, process owners, risk register, and decision rights | Approve business case, success measures, and escalation model |
| Assess | Document current state and readiness | Complete discovery and assessment, business process analysis, data review, and integration inventory | Validate target priorities and sequencing assumptions |
| Design | Define future-state operating model | Approve solution design, controls, role model, reporting ownership, and cloud migration strategy where relevant | Sign off on process standards and exception policy |
| Build and validate | Configure, integrate, test, and prepare users | Run governance reviews for data quality, security, training readiness, and cutover planning | Authorize go-live based on operational readiness criteria |
| Stabilize and optimize | Protect continuity and realize value | Monitor adoption, issue trends, KPI performance, and support effectiveness | Approve optimization backlog and managed services model |
This roadmap works best when each phase has measurable exit criteria. Many healthcare ERP programs move too quickly from design into build without resolving ownership questions. That creates downstream delays in testing, training, and cutover. A disciplined roadmap protects the organization from false progress by requiring evidence of readiness before advancing.
Where healthcare ERP programs commonly lose value
- Treating revenue cycle and supply chain as separate workstreams with no shared KPI model, which leads to conflicting priorities and fragmented reporting.
- Underestimating master data governance, especially item, vendor, contract, and financial mapping dependencies that affect both billing accuracy and spend control.
- Designing around legacy exceptions instead of standardizing processes, which increases complexity and weakens scalability.
- Delaying change management and training strategy until late in the project, resulting in low user confidence and inconsistent adoption.
- Ignoring operational readiness, monitoring, observability, and support workflows, which shifts unresolved issues into the go-live period.
- Selecting deployment patterns or cloud services before clarifying governance, compliance, security, and support responsibilities.
These mistakes are not merely project issues. They are governance failures. When executive sponsors frame them that way, corrective action becomes easier because the organization can address root causes rather than symptoms.
How to govern risk, compliance, security, and continuity without slowing the program
Healthcare ERP governance must protect financial integrity and operational continuity while keeping the program moving. The most effective approach is to embed risk and control reviews into standard delivery checkpoints rather than treating them as separate approval layers. Security should cover identity and access management, role segregation, privileged access, auditability, and integration trust boundaries. Compliance reviews should focus on financial controls, procurement policy adherence, data handling responsibilities, and retention requirements relevant to the organization's operating environment.
Business continuity planning should be practical and scenario-based. Leaders should define what happens if cutover is delayed, if a critical interface fails, if inventory visibility is incomplete, or if billing operations need temporary fallback procedures. Monitoring and observability are directly relevant here because they provide early warning during stabilization. For cloud-hosted environments, managed cloud services can support resilience, patching discipline, backup oversight, and incident response coordination, but governance must still define who owns service decisions and business communication.
What drives adoption, ROI, and long-term customer success
Adoption is strongest when users understand not only how the ERP works, but why process changes matter to enterprise performance. A user adoption strategy should segment audiences by role, decision authority, and workflow impact. Executives need KPI visibility and governance reporting. Managers need exception handling and accountability clarity. Frontline users need role-based training, job aids, and support channels tied to real scenarios. Customer onboarding principles are useful internally here: treat business teams as stakeholders entering a new service model, not simply recipients of software training.
ROI should be evaluated across labor efficiency, control improvement, working capital discipline, purchasing compliance, reduced reconciliation effort, and better decision quality. Not every benefit appears immediately after go-live. Some gains depend on post-launch optimization, workflow automation maturity, and customer lifecycle management disciplines that sustain process ownership over time. This is why many partners and enterprise teams use managed implementation services after launch. The goal is not indefinite dependency. It is structured stabilization, issue reduction, and capability transfer.
